1Wash and dry all produce. Bring a large pot of salted water to a boil. Halve, peel, and thinly slice shallot . Thinly slice garlic . Trim, then slice button mushrooms . Roughly chop peanuts . Peel and mince ginger until you have 1 tbsp. Pick leaves from basil and tear into small pieces. Thinly slice chili pepper .shallot: 2 unit, garlic: 4 clove, button mushrooms: 8 oz, peanuts: 2 oz, ginger: 2 thumb, basil: ½ ounce, chili pepper: 1 unit -
2Heat a drizzle of vegetable oil in a large pan over medium-high heat. Add garlic and cook until fragrant, ⏱️ 30 seconds . Add broccoli florets and toss. Pour in ½ cup water and cook, tossing occasionally, until tender, ⏱️ 4-5 minutes . Season with salt and pepper . Remove from pan and set aside.vegetable oil: 2 tbsp, broccoli florets: 1 lb, salt, pepper -
3Heat another drizzle of oil in the same pan over medium-high heat. Add mushrooms and cook until softened and a few shades darker, ⏱️ 4-5 minutes . Season with salt and pepper, then set aside with broccoli. -
4Once water is boiling, add wide rice noodles to the pot. Remove from heat and let soak until al dente, ⏱️ 6-7 minutes . Drain and rinse under cold water. Meanwhile, stir together soy sauce , ½ TBSP sesame oil , and 1 TBSP sugar in a small bowl .wide rice noodles: 12 oz, soy sauce: 4 tbsp, sesame oil: 1 tbsp, sugar: 2 tbsp -
5In the same pan, heat another drizzle of oil. Add shallot and chili pepper to taste. Cook until softened, ⏱️ 2-3 minutes . Toss in ginger and shrimp and cook until shrimp are starting to turn opaque, ⏱️ 2 minutes . Season with salt and pepper. Add rice noodles and the soy sauce mixture to the pan and toss to coat.shrimp: 20 oz -
6Add broccoli, mushrooms, and basil leaves to the pan. Cook, tossing constantly, until shrimp are cooked through and everything is well combined, ⏱️ 2 minutes . Divide between bowls and sprinkle with more peanuts.
